Last year the enlivened volumes of intermodal transport from the Kombiverkehr have grown of +0.7%
the national traffic is increased of +0.6% and that international one of +0.8%
February 6, 2017
In the 2016 Kombiverkehr German has enlivened on track an intermodal traffic pairs to 985.424 street shipments (for a volume pairs to 19,7 million container teu), with an increment of +0.7% regarding 978.095 shipments (1,96 million teu) in the year precedence.
Last year the volume of national traffic has been pairs to 202.927 street shipments (+0.6%), while the international traffic has been attested to 782.498 street shipments (+0.8%).
"Even if in last the twelve months the intermodal transport has had to be confronted with the low levels of the costs of the diesel oil, with international strikes and with the been extended closing of the national and international terminal of Ludwigshafen - it has emphasized the managing director of Kombiverkehr, Armin Riedl - it has turned out however obvious that a sustainable increase of the national and international traffic is still possible. The harmonization of the legislation in all the EU and the existing measures of support let alone fair conditions of competition between the modalities of transport on road and track - it has found Riedl - would have ulteriorly to increase the demand for transport arranged from the today's customers but also of those potential ones and to not only promote the passage to the railroad that is environment-friendly".
